May Smartphones Lead You Older Quickly? - Part 1 – Health Life 18

As reported by bankmycell (2022) that there are about 6.64 billion smartphones in the world. It is mean around 83.7% people have own smartphones.

Almost every bodies have smartphones.



Fig 01- Tech neck due to look down to mobile phone 
(credit to Dreamtime)

Then, what is relationship between smartphone and health issues or smartphones affect on let’s say aging?

We might know that a lot of factors or combine factors may lead to aging faster. Just for few example are:

- Lack of sleep (normal sleep is 6 to 8 hours a day).
- Smoking
- Drinking
- sunlight
- Sitting more than normal.

Many people use their mobile phone to conduct activities such as:

- Reading and sending messages
- Check their social medias: twitter, face book, blogging
- Internet connecting to search information
- Play game
- Update with news
- Watching TV and Film

If above activities need looking down to mobile phone too long, it would cause what experts call as “tech neck.”
